Vocaloid:

sorry but I have to step in and clarify on what the definitions of electromagnetic and mechanical waves actually are. it has nothing to do with what is "earth-related" or "machine-related" mechanical waves transfer energy through the oscillation of matter electromagnetic waves transfer energy caused by the propagation of an electric and magnetic field. unlike mechanical waves, electromagnetic waves can travel through a medium.

Vocaloid:

from your table, you have three examples of electromagnetic waves and three types of mechanical waves. as a major hint there is one entry in the left column that needs to be swapped with an item from the right column. to figure this out, you need to know how each of these waves is classified. for example, ocean waves *does* belong in the mechanical wave column because an ocean wave transfers energy through the movement of matter (water.) likewise, x-rays are a type of electromagnetic wave because they can propogate energy w/o a medium. go through the other choices and classify them according to whether they are a mechanical or electromagnetic wave.
